Skyscanner logo

Senior Full Stack Software Engineer

Skyscanner

Job Description

Overview

As a Senior Full Stack Software Engineer at Skyscanner, you will play a crucial role in building and scaling our front-end codebase to support our mission of making travel booking more sustainable and straightforward for over 100 million travelers. You will be part of a dynamic team that values collaboration, ambition, and empowerment.

Responsibilities

  • Front-End Development: Utilize modern front-end technologies such as TypeScript, Sass/Less, Webpack, and npm to build scalable and efficient user interfaces.
  • Back-End Development: Work with server-side technologies including Node.js, Python, and Java to develop robust backend services.
  • API Development: Design and implement APIs that are secure, efficient, and scalable.
  • Team Collaboration: Work closely with internal customers, providing first-line support and handling administrative tasks for core systems.
  • Project Accountability: Take ownership of your projects, ensuring timely delivery and high-quality outcomes.

Requirements

  • Proven experience in full stack development, with a strong emphasis on both front-end and back-end technologies.
  • Familiarity with cloud services, data engineering/ETL, and real-time data accuracy.
  • A strong sense of team spirit and dedication to customer satisfaction.
  • Curiosity and interest in security and automation.

Benefits

  • Medical Insurance: Comprehensive health coverage.
  • Mental Health Support: Access to Headspace subscriptions.
  • Flexible Work Environment: Hybrid working model with the option to work from any country for 4 weeks a year.
  • Professional Development: Opportunities to learn and grow within a global leader in travel.
  • Additional Perks: Home office allowance, the option to buy more holiday, and the ability to work from our global offices for 30 days.

Work Environment

Skyscanner operates on a hybrid working model, encouraging employees to meet in person on average 8 days per month to foster innovation and collaboration.

Join us in our mission to elevate the travel experience and make a positive impact on the world.


Note: This position is based in Barcelona, Spain, and offers a competitive salary and benefits package.

Benefits
Extracted with AI

  • Medical insurance
  • Headspace subscriptions
  • Home office allowance
  • Option to buy more holiday
  • Work from any country for 4 weeks a year
  • 30 days in other global offices

Similar jobs

Last update: 23 minutes ago

Booking.com logo
Booking.com

Full Stack Software Engineer

Join Booking.com as a Full Stack Software Engineer in Amsterdam. Work on global e-commerce challenges with Java, JavaScript, React, and more.

Ilkari logo
Ilkari

Senior Software Engineer - Python, Django, Angular

Join Ilkari as a Senior Software Engineer to lead development in Python, Django, and Angular, creating scalable solutions in a hybrid work environment.

Computer Futures logo
Computer Futures

Mid-Level Full Stack Software Engineer - Cloud & Web

Join as a Full Stack Software Engineer focusing on C#, Azure, and Microservices in a dynamic team with flexible work options.

Polarsteps logo
Polarsteps

Senior Frontend Engineer with React and TypeScript

Join Polarsteps as a Senior Frontend Engineer in Amsterdam. Work with React, TypeScript, and more in a hybrid environment.

PiNCAMP logo
PiNCAMP

Senior Full Stack Engineer

Join PiNCAMP as a Senior Full Stack Engineer to build innovative camping solutions using Python, JavaScript, and cloud technologies.

WorkFlex logo
WorkFlex

Full-Stack Software Engineer (Angular and Java)

Join WorkFlex as a Full-Stack Software Engineer specializing in Angular and Java. Work remotely and help build our next-gen platform.

Aiven logo
Aiven

Staff Software Engineer

Join Aiven as a Staff Software Engineer to develop cloud operations platforms using open-source technologies. Hybrid work in Berlin.

NAVARA logo
NAVARA

Fullstack Developer with Angular and C#

Join Navara as a Fullstack Developer in Amsterdam, working with Angular, C#, and modern tech stacks. Competitive salary and benefits offered.

Agoda logo
Agoda

Lead Full Stack Software Engineer

Lead Full Stack Software Engineer role in Amsterdam, focusing on React, GraphQL, and modern web technologies. Hybrid work environment.

HeyJobs logo
HeyJobs

Senior Software Engineer - AWS, Python, Ruby on Rails

Join HeyJobs as a Senior Software Engineer to design scalable systems using AWS, Python, and Ruby on Rails in a dynamic team.

Agoda logo
Agoda

Lead Full Stack Software Engineer

Lead Full Stack Software Engineer role in Hamburg, Germany. Requires expertise in React, TypeScript, and agile methodologies. Hybrid work environment.

MoonPay logo
MoonPay

Senior Full Stack Engineer - Consumer

Join MoonPay as a Senior Full Stack Engineer in Lisbon, focusing on consumer products using React, TypeScript, and GCP.

mobile.de logo
mobile.de

Full Stack Software Engineer (d/f/m)

Join mobile.de as a Full Stack Software Engineer in Berlin, working with Java, JavaScript, and Kotlin in a hybrid environment.

BlueBranch GmbH logo
BlueBranch GmbH

Remote FullStack Developer (m/w/d)

Join our dynamic IT company as a Remote FullStack Developer, working with JavaScript, Node.js, and Python. Flexible hours and remote work.

Basic-Fit logo
Basic-Fit

Senior Full-Stack Developer

Join Basic-Fit as a Senior Full-Stack Developer in Tilburg. Work with React, Node.js, and more to enhance fitness experiences across Europe.

OnHires logo
OnHires

Senior Full Stack Engineer (PHP, Angular, React)

Seeking a Senior Full Stack Engineer with PHP, Angular, React expertise for remote work in the EU. 6+ years experience required.

Metroscope logo
Metroscope

Senior Software Engineer - Full Stack/Back-End with Python and TypeScript

Join Metroscope as a Senior Software Engineer in Paris, working on innovative energy solutions with Python and TypeScript in a hybrid environment.

LEGALFLY logo
LEGALFLY

Back End Engineer with Node.js and TypeScript

Join LegalFly as a Back End Engineer to revolutionize legal AI with Node.js and TypeScript in a hybrid role in Ghent.

Motius logo
Motius

Senior Backend Developer

Join Motius as a Senior Backend Developer to work on cutting-edge R&D projects using AWS, Docker, GraphQL, and more in a hybrid work environment.

Tiqets logo
Tiqets

Senior Backend Developer

Join Tiqets as a Senior Backend Developer in Amsterdam. Work with AWS, Python, and SQL in a hybrid environment.

N26 logo
N26

Backend Engineer - Financial Empowerment

Join N26 as a Backend Engineer to empower financial freedom using Java, Kotlin, and microservices in a hybrid work environment.

Intuitech logo
Intuitech

Fullstack Developer (Java, Spring, Angular, React)

Join Intuitech as a Fullstack Developer in Budapest. Work with Java, Spring, Angular, React in a hybrid setup. Great benefits and growth opportunities.

T-Digital by Deutsche Telekom logo
T-Digital by Deutsche Telekom

Senior Fullstack Developer (Java, Spring Boot, Angular)

Join T-Digital as a Senior Fullstack Developer to innovate secure login systems using Java, Spring Boot, and Angular. Fully remote work available.

Transavia logo
Transavia

Senior PEGA Developer

Join Transavia as a Senior PEGA Developer to enhance customer experiences using PEGA platform and cutting-edge technologies.